How much does a Hysterectomy cost in Minnesota?

Hysterectomy (laparoscopic) · CPT 58571 · State: Minnesota

In Minnesota, the typical insurer-negotiated price for a Hysterectomy (laparoscopic) is about $10,088, with most between $1,698 and $10,352 ($2,237 cash/self-pay). Based on 72 Minnesota hospitals — 24% higher than the national typical of $8,117.

How much does a Hysterectomy (laparoscopic) cost without insurance in Minnesota?

Cash or self-pay prices for a Hysterectomy (laparoscopic) in Minnesota run around $2,237. Hospitals often bill the higher "list" charge first (about $3,522), so ask for the cash or self-pay rate.
